This small star-shaped ornament is constructed using fabric remnants from preloved saris. The outer structure is sewn from upcycled sari textiles, with internal filling composed of soft chindi scraps to provide volume and form. Each unit is hand-stitched, ensuring structural integrity while maintaining a lightweight profile suitable for hanging. Lighting and screens may cause slight variations in color appearance.

How I am sustainable

I'm not made from virgin fabrics and dyes, so my carbon footprint, pollution and water usage is way lower than other products. Instead, I'm made with circular production methods, from waste fabric which already existed. I turned into an I was a Sari instead of becoming landfill. Now I'm looking forward to my second life, maybe with you.

How to care for me

I was collected from Mumbai markets rather than being newly made, so my exact fabric composition is unknown. Care for me sustainably with hand wash, line drying and cool iron. I can also be machine washed and dry cleaned if I don't come with embroidery or embellishments that might be affected.
